What are Fallen Timbers jobs?

Fallen Timbers jobs typically refer to employment opportunities at The Shops at Fallen Timbers, an open-air shopping center located in Maumee, Ohio. These jobs can include retail positions, restaurant staff, management roles, and maintenance or security positions within the shopping center. Applicants may find both part-time and full-time positions, depending on the needs of the various stores and businesses. Working at Fallen Timbers offers experience in customer service, sales, and hospitality, and is popular among students and those seeking flexible work hours.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Timber Faller,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Timber Faller, you need expertise in tree felling techniques, chainsaw operation, and a solid understanding of forestry safety practices, often supported by formal training or certification. Familiarity with tools like power saws, wedges, and personal protective equipment (PPE) is essential, alongside knowledge of logging regulations and first aid. Physical stamina, attention to detail, and strong situational awareness are crucial soft skills for working safely and efficiently in challenging outdoor environments. These skills and qualities are vital to ensure personal safety, environmental stewardship, and productivity in this hazardous profession.

About Otterbein SeniorLife

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Otterbein SeniorLife is a health and human services industry institution based in Lebanon, OH, US. Established in 1912, the organization has a century-old heritage of providing senior-focused services. Otterbein SeniorLife offers a full spectrum of health and human services including continuing care retirement communities and home health and hospice services. Upholding the values of inclusiveness, quality, innovation, and stewardship, the organization is widely recognized as a faith-based, non-profit ministry. Their mission is to enhance the quality of life and holistic growth of older persons.
